THIS NEWS RELEASE IS INTENDED FOR DISTRIBUTION IN CANADA ONLY AND IS NOT AUTHORIZED FOR DISTRIBUTION TO UNITED STATES NEWSWIRE SERVICES OR FOR DISSEMINATION IN THE UNITED STATES. Silvermet Inc. ("Silvermet" or the "Company") (TSX VENTURE:SYI) is pleased to announce solid financial and operating results for 2011. Highlights (in US$) -- All corporate debt has been retired. Silvermet is debt free and with cash and credit facility receivables of $4.1 million at December 31, 2011, or $0.026 per share. -- Production in 2011 increased by 33% to 15,328 Dry Metric Tonnes ("DMT") zinc concentrate containing 69% zinc compared to 2010 production of 11,548 DMT. -- Sales volume in 2011 increased by 15% to 14,421 DMT from 12,581 DMT in 2010. -- Revenues in 2011 increased by 10% to $17.6 million (at 100%) (Silvermet's share - $8.6 million) from $15.9 million in 2010. -- In 2011 57,000 DMT of EAFD was processed, an increase of 10% from 2010. -- In Q1, 2012, Silvermet's Turkish joint venture company, Befesa Silvermet Turkey ("BST"), signed two purchase agreements to acquire plant sites in the Adana and Izmir Tire organized industrial zones. At the new sites, the BST joint venture intends to build two "state of the art" plants to process 220,000 tonnes of EAFD per year, which will quintuple BST's production capacity in Turkey. Silvermet has been generating positive cash flows since Q3, 2010 and 2011 was a record year of production and sales. The working capital position of the Company continues to strengthen with no debt, established operations, relatively stable zinc prices and lower treatment charges. The Turkish joint venture has recently signed two purchase agreements for new plant sites. The Adana plant site is 50,000 square meters located in the Adana organized industrial zone near Iskenderun. The Company intends to build a modern plant to process 110,000 tonnes of EAFD per year in Adana. BST has also signed a purchase agreement to acquire an additional 68,000 square meter property in Izmir Tire organized industrial zone, on which a second 110,000 tonne plant will be built. "After the planned addition of the two new plants in Turkey, annual EAFD processing capacity will increase to 280,000 tonnes. EAFD processed in Turkey contains an average of 25% zinc. The double washed Waelz oxide output of the Turkish plants will therefore increase to approximately 90,000 DMT per annum, containing approximately 135 million pounds of zinc." said Stephen G. Roman, Silvermet's Chairman, President and CEO. "2012 is shaping up to be an exciting year with very positive results at the existing plant while two major expansion initiatives will be launched simultaneously." About Silvermet: Silvermet's principal business activity is the recycling of electric arc furnace dust ("EAFD") obtained from steel companies through a Waelz kiln to recover zinc concentrates that are then sold to zinc smelters throughout the world. The Company owns 49% of BST, which operates a Waelz kiln facility located in Iskenderun, Turkey.
